About the role
- The role is on the critical path to the financial success of the business.
- You are responsible for taking AI model backbones and delivering an autonomous vehicle capability roadmap with production-level quality.
- This includes collecting, filtering and selecting the most relevant training data; and then training, tuning, debugging production models.
